How do these Flippa alternatives compare on cost and features?

Fee structures vary more than most buyers expect, and the difference between platforms can cost you tens of thousands of dollars on a single deal.

BizBuySell is the largest business-for-sale marketplace in the US, with over 200,000 successful sales and 120,000 businesses listed annually. Its scale is unmatched for brick-and-mortar businesses, franchises, and hybrid companies with both physical and online components. For pure digital assets, though, that breadth works against you: listings are less curated, and buyers carry more of the due diligence burden.

Empire Flippers has facilitated a very large amount of transactions across eCommerce, SaaS, affiliate marketing, and digital products. It vets every listing before it goes live, verifying traffic and financials, which means buyers encounter far fewer surprises. Empire Flippers also offers done-for-you business migration support to reduce downtime during transfer, a service most self-serve platforms skip entirely.

Hands calculating business transaction costs

Quiet Light Brokerage takes a high-touch approach: dedicated advisors, thorough due diligence, and direct buyer support throughout the transaction. It suits sellers who want a professional to manage the process rather than navigate a marketplace alone.

Infographic ranking best Flippa alternatives in US marketplaces

FE International stands apart for mid-market deals. With over 1,500 transactions and more than $50B in value advised, it specializes in technology M&A including FinTech, SaaS, and cybersecurity. Its full advisory model covers due diligence, capital raise, and private sales, making it the right call for complex tech exits rather than sub-$100K content site flips.

THE INVESTORS CLUB rejects more than half of all listing submissions, keeping quality high. Sellers pay no listing fee and face no mandatory success fee, which is a meaningful contrast to platforms charging significant success fees on closed deals. Listings skew toward smaller content and eCommerce sites, mostly lower-priced offerings.

Flippi.ai operates as a digital asset marketplace based in Boca Raton, Florida. Fee structures and sales volume are not publicly listed, so buyers should contact them directly before committing.

Key feature differences at a glance:

  • Empire Flippers and Quiet Light Brokerage verify financials before listing; Flippa and BizBuySell do not.
  • THE INVESTORS CLUB charges no mandatory success fee; most other platforms charge a significant success fee on closed deals.
  • FE International focuses exclusively on technology businesses; BizBuySell covers all business types.
  • Empire Flippers includes migration support; self-serve platforms leave that to the buyer.
  • Curated marketplaces reduce buyer risk by pre-vetting listings, unlike open platforms where verification is the buyer's responsibility.

How to choose the right platform for buying or selling online businesses

The right platform depends on three things: what you're selling, how much it's worth, and how much help you want.

Two professionals discussing online business sale options

For high-value tech or SaaS businesses, broker-led platforms like FE International or Quiet Light Brokerage justify their commissions through deal structure, buyer qualification, and transition management. Full-service platforms handle escrow setup, NDA management, and post-sale support, which protects both sides on complex transactions. Self-serve marketplaces make sense for smaller deals where the economics of a 15% broker commission don't add up.

Asset type matters just as much as deal size. BizBuySell works well for hybrid businesses with physical and online components, but pure digital assets benefit from specialized platforms. Content sites belong on THE INVESTORS CLUB or similar curated options. SaaS and tech startups fit Empire Flippers or FE International. Choosing a platform built for your asset type means your listing reaches buyers who are actually looking for it.

Checklist before you commit to a platform:

  • Does the platform specialize in your asset type (content, SaaS, eCommerce, franchise)?
  • Are listings vetted, or does the buyer verify independently?
  • What are the total fees: listing, success, and any membership costs?
  • Does the platform offer escrow, NDA management, or migration support?
  • What is the typical deal size on the platform, and does yours fit?

Pro Tip: Ask each platform for their average time-to-close and buyer qualification process before listing. A platform with a smaller but pre-qualified buyer pool often closes faster than one with a massive, unvetted audience.


What experts say about digital asset marketplaces and domain branding

The shift toward curated marketplaces reflects a real frustration: Flippa's size makes consistent listing quality nearly impossible to maintain. Buyers and sellers increasingly prefer platforms that verify financial claims and traffic data before a listing goes live, because the cost of a bad acquisition far exceeds any fee savings from a cheaper platform.

Hidden transaction costs catch buyers off guard more often than the headline fees do. Migration assistance, technical transfer support, and working capital requirements add up fast. Platforms like Empire Flippers build these services in; on open marketplaces, you source and pay for them separately.

Niche platforms also offer a targeting advantage. A content site listed on THE INVESTORS CLUB reaches an audience specifically hunting for content businesses. The same listing on a general marketplace competes with thousands of unrelated assets for buyer attention.
